Microprocessor relaying for generator protection on stator asymmetrical short-circuits, rotor overheating and field failure

Journal of Microcomputer Applications, 1988
Abstract The fact that a loss of symmetry in the stator currents of a generator produces a second harmonic component in the field circuit is used in the reported work to detect all asymmetrical faults on the stator side, including inter-turn short-circuits.

A Survey on Recent development of Asymmetrical Three-Phase Short Circuit Faults Computation in Power Systems

2019 6th International Conference on Soft Computing & Machine Intelligence (ISCMI), 2019
Asymmetrical three-phase short circuit faults occur more often than symmetrical three-phase short circuits faults. The asymmetrical three-phase short circuit faults can be line-to-line faults, double line-to-earth faults or line-to-earth faults.
